Output e85f680f3990f996fb7b36cd2499d048432e49dbd20665f56daa069401147003:65
- value
- 10668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1ef5c005b04df29900e6de160996856113c013c OP_EQUAL
- address
- 3KNT5YkrsPXhHcRQjK2b8GCxfdkJ67p1BK
- transaction
- e85f680f3990f996fb7b36cd2499d048432e49dbd20665f56daa069401147003
- confirmations
- 198654
- spent
- true